# Leadership Review Briefing: Tallowgate Term Sheet

Tallowgate Industries has proposed a three-year co-development agreement: 4.2M upfront, staged royalties at 6%, and exclusivity in the Ferrow Basin market. Counsel flags the termination clause as unusually broad; finance should model downside exposure before Thursday's session. Our negotiating posture depends on the strategic context noted below.

board note of baweg-bawig: Project Tamath slips by six weeks because of the audit delay.

## Idempotency Keys for Payment Retries (Lumopay)

Every retry of a charge request must reuse the original idempotency key; generating a new key on retry can produce duplicate charges. Keys are scoped per merchant and expire after 48 hours. Reviewers should verify keys are derived server-side, never from client input. The full key-generation specification and threat model are maintained on the internal page.

dashboard of kaguf-tawip = https://vault.merlaqsys.test/issue

Subject: Quickstore 4.2 — bloom filter now fronts the KV layer

Plugin authors: starting with this release, Quickstore places a bloom filter ahead of the key-value store. Negative lookups return faster; false positives fall through safely. No API changes are required on your side. Verify your plugin against the staging build referenced below.

session token of fahif-tadup = htk3_9c7

/*
 * Rebalancing constants for the Spokewise fleet tool.
 * These bound how aggressively vans are dispatched to move
 * bikes between docks in the Ferngate district. Limits exist
 * to prevent a compromised scheduler from issuing runaway
 * dispatch loops; each is enforced server-side. Reviewers
 * should verify changes against the threat model. Values:
 */

tuning table, kajog-bawip:
TIERS = {
    "kelius": 256,
    "lammir": 543,
}

# Read-replica lag alarm (Quillgate plugin authors, please read)
# The lagwatch module polls the replica every 20 seconds and raises
# REPLICA_LAG_HIGH when drift exceeds the threshold set below. Plugins
# must never write through the replica handle, even during an alarm;
# queue writes locally and let the primary drain them. If your plugin
# needs its own probe, reuse the shared pool rather than opening fresh
# sockets. The replica pool is initialized from the connection string
# that follows.

replica DSN, kajep-yahag: mssql://praok_svc:iF@db-8d68.plorvaio.local:5432/eliion